Ситуация, когда компьютер зависает при переключении окон, знакома многим пользователям, от геймеров до офисных сотрудников. Вы нажимаете привычное сочетание клавиш Alt + Tab или используете жест тачпада, а вместо мгновенного отклика система замирает на несколько секунд или даже дольше. Это не просто раздражающий фактор, это сигнал о том, что операционная система не справляется с управлением ресурсами в реальном времени.
Чаще всего проблема кроется в конфликте программ, устаревших драйверах или неправильных настройках электропитания. Графический интерфейс Windows, известный как DWM (Desktop Window Manager), берет на себя ответственность за отрисовку всех открытых приложений. Если этот процесс перегружен или работает некорректно, вы видите характерные задержки, рывки и фризы.
Игнорировать такие симптомы нельзя, так как они могут указывать на более глубокие системные сбои. В этой статье мы подробно разберем, почему Windows 10 и Windows 11 могут тормозить при смене задач, и предложим пошаговые методы устранения неисправностей. Вы научитесь диагностировать проблему и вернете своему ПК былую отзывчивость.
Основные причины тормозов при смене активных задач
Фундаментальной причиной того, что система зависает при переключении окон, часто является нехватка оперативной памяти. Когда вы открываете множество вкладок в браузере, фоновые приложения и тяжелые программы, свободный объем RAM стремительно уменьшается. Компьютер начинает использовать файл подкачки на жестком диске, который работает значительно медленнее оперативной памяти, что вызывает заметные задержки.
Второй важный аспект — это состояние драйверов видеокарты. Графический ускоритель отвечает за композицию окон и анимацию интерфейса. Если установлен старый, битый или несовместимый драйвер, процесс Desktop Window Manager не может эффективно выполнять свои функции. Особенно это актуально после крупных обновлений операционной системы, когда старые драйверы перестают корректно взаимодействовать с новыми компонентами ядра.
⚠️ Внимание: Если вы недавно обновили драйвер видеокарты и проблема появилась сразу после этого, высока вероятность, что новая версия содержит ошибки. В таком случае стоит выполнить откат к предыдущей стабильной версии через диспетчер устройств.
Также стоит учитывать влияние фоновых процессов. Антивирусы, облачные хранилища и системы обновления могут потреблять ресурсы процессора именно в моменты вашей активности. Когда вы пытаетесь переключиться, система вынуждена приостанавливать фоновые задачи или, наоборот, активировать спящие процессы, что вызывает кратковременный, но ощутимый ступор.
Диагностика и проверка системных ресурсов
Прежде чем вносить изменения в реестр или переустанавливать драйверы, необходимо точно определить узкое место. Для этого существует встроенный инструмент Диспетчер задач. Нажмите Ctrl + Shift + Esc, чтобы открыть его, и перейдите на вкладку «Производительность». Обратите внимание на графики загрузки ЦП, памяти и диска в момент, когда вы пытаетесь переключить окна.
Если вы видите, что диск загружен на 100% даже в простое, это верный признак проблем с накопителем или фоновой индексацией. В случае с оперативной памятью критическим считается заполнение более 90% объема. Высокая загрузка процессора может указывать на зависший процесс или вирусную активность, которая маскируется под системные службы.
- HDD (Жесткий диск)
- SSD (Твердотельный накопитель)
- NVMe M.2
- Не знаю / Гибридный
Для более глубокого анализа можно использовать утилиту Resource Monitor. Введите resmon в строке поиска меню «Пуск» и запустите приложение. Оно покажет детализированный список процессов, обращающихся к диску прямо сейчас. Часто оказывается, что какой-то неизвестный сервис постоянно读写 данные, блокируя отклик интерфейса.
Оптимизация графических настроек и драйверов
Наиболее действенный способ решить проблему, когда компьютер зависает при переключении окон, — это обновление или переустановка драйверов видеокарты. Не полагайтесь на автоматические средства Windows Update, так как они часто устанавливают универсальные, но не оптимизированные версии. Лучше всего скачать актуальный пакет с официального сайта производителя: NVIDIA, AMD или Intel.
При установке драйверов выберите режим «Чистая установка». Это полностью удалит старые конфигурационные файлы и настройки, которые могли вызвать конфликт. После перезагрузки система создаст свежий профиль для работы с графикой. Также стоит проверить настройки панели управления видеокартой.
- 🎮 Убедитесь, что режим управления электропитанием установлен на «Максимальная производительность».
- 🖥️ Отключите вертикальную синхронизацию (V-Sync) для рабочего стола, если такая опция доступна в глобальных настройках.
- 🔄 Проверьте, не включена ли опция энергосбережения для PCIe, которая может снижать частоты шины.
Если проблема сохраняется, попробуйте изменить настройки быстродействия Windows. Перейдите в Панель управления → Система → Дополнительные параметры системы → Быстродействие. Здесь можно отключить анимацию окон, тени и другие визуальные эффекты, которые нагружают графический процессор при переключении задач.
Настройка электропитания и процессов Windows
Схема электропитания напрямую влияет на то, как быстро процессор реагирует на ваши действия. В режиме «Экономия энергии» частоты CPU искусственно занижаются, что приводит к лагам при резком изменении нагрузки, например, при открытии нового окна. Переключиться на высокопроизводительный режим можно через командную строку.
powercfg -setactive SCHEME_MAX
Эта команда активирует схему «Высокая производительность». Если такой схемы нет в списке, ее можно создать или активировать скрытую схему «Максимальная производительность». Это особенно актуально для ноутбуков, подключенных к сети, где система по умолчанию может ограничивать мощность.
☑️ Проверка настроек электропитания
Еще один важный параметр — управление фоновыми приложениями. В Windows 10 и 11 множество встроенных приложений работают в фоне, потребляя ресурсы. Перейдите в Параметры → Конфиденциальность → Фоновые приложения и отключите те программы, которые вам не нужны постоянно. Это освободит циклы процессора для основных задач.
Работа с файлом подкачки и виртуальной памятью
Когда физической памяти не хватает, Windows использует часть жесткого диска как расширение RAM. Этот файл называется pagefile.sys. Если он фрагментирован или имеет неоптимальный размер, переключение между тяжелыми приложениями будет вызывать зависания. Рекомендуется настроить этот параметок вручную.
Зайдите в настройки быстродействия, вкладка «Дополнительно», и нажмите «Изменить» в разделе виртуальной памяти. Снимите галочку с автоматического выбора размера. Для систем с SSD оптимально установить фиксированный размер, равный объему установленной оперативной памяти, или оставить управление системой, если диск достаточно быстр.
| Объем RAM | Рекомендуемый мин. размер (МБ) | Рекомендуемый макс. размер (МБ) | Тип диска |
|---|---|---|---|
| 4 ГБ | 4096 | 8192 | SSD/HDD |
| 8 ГБ | 4096 | 8192 | SSD |
| 16 ГБ и более | 2048 | 4096 | SSD/NVMe |
| Любой объем | По выбору системы | По выбору системы | NVMe (быстрый) |
Важно понимать, что на медленных HDD увеличение файла подкачки не даст прироста скорости, а лишь снизит износ диска за счет уменьшения фрагментации. Критическим фактором здесь является именно тип накопителя: на SSD даже большой файл подкачки обрабатывается достаточно быстро, чтобы не вызывать заметных фризов интерфейса.
Специфические проблемы Windows 10 и 11
В последних версиях операционной системы Microsoft внедрила функцию «Просмотр задач» и улучшенную работу с несколькими рабочими столами. Эти функции требуют дополнительных ресурсов. Если у вас слабый компьютер, отключение прозрачности и эффектов в меню «Персонализация» может существенно улучшить отзывчивость.
Также известна проблема с «быстрым запуском» (Fast Startup). Эта функция сохраняет состояние ядра системы на диск при выключении, что ускоряет загрузку, но может приводить к накоплению ошибок в сеансе. Если компьютер зависает при переключении окон после долгой работы без перезагрузки, попробуйте выполнить полную перезагрузку.
Как выполнить полную перезагрузку?
Для полной очистки памяти и перезапуска всех служб не используйте режим «Завершение работы» и последующее включение. Нажмите «Пуск», затем кнопку питания и, удерживая клавишу Shift, выберите «Перезагрузка». Это принудительно закроет все сеансы и запустит систему с чистого листа.
Проверьте целостность системных файлов. Поврежденные библиотеки DLL могут вызывать нестабильность проводника и диспетчера окон. Запустите командную строку от имени администратора и выполните команду:
sfc /scannow
После завершения сканирования и восстановления (если оно потребуется) обязательно перезагрузите компьютер. Это действие устраняет множество логических ошибок, накопленных в ходе эксплуатации.
Дополнительные методы и утилиты
Если стандартные методы не помогли, стоит обратить внимание на сторонний софт, который может конфликтовать с системой. Программы для записи экрана, оверлеи Discord или Steam, а также виджеты рабочего стола часто перехватывают управление окнами. Попробуйте выполнить «чистую загрузку» Windows, отключив все сторонние службы.
Для пользователей видеокарт NVIDIA существует специфическая настройка в панели управления: «Режим управления электропитаниемом». Убедитесь, что для глобальных настроек или конкретно для процесса explorer.exe выбрано предпочтение высокой производительности. Это предотвратит сброс частот GPU в моменты простоя, что часто вызывает задержку при активации окна.
Используйте утилиту Microsoft PowerToys. В ней есть функция «Always on Top» и улучшенный переключатель окон, который работает стабильнее стандартного и потребляет меньше ресурсов на старых машинах.
В крайних случаях, когда программные методы бессильны, проблема может крыться в аппаратной части. Перегрев процессора или видеокарты вызывает троттлинг (снижение частот), что проявляется в виде резких замерзаний системы. Проверьте температуры компонентов под нагрузкой с помощью утилит HWMonitor или AIDA64.
Комплексный подход: сочетание обновления драйверов, настройки схемы электропитания и оптимизации файла подкачки решает 95% проблем с зависанием при переключении окон.
Часто задаваемые вопросы (FAQ)
Почему ноутбук зависает сильнее при работе от батареи?
В режиме от батареи система автоматически снижает производительность процессора и видеокарты для экономии заряда. Переключите схему электропитания на «Высокая производительность» даже в автономном режиме, если скорость работы важнее времени работы от аккумулятора.
Может ли вирус вызывать лаги при переключении окон?
Да, майнеры и трояны часто маскируются под системные процессы и загружают ЦП на 100%. При попытке переключить окно антивирус или система безопасности могут блокировать вредоносный процесс, вызывая задержку. Проведите полную проверку системы.
Поможет ли добавление оперативной памяти?
Если в Диспетчере задач вы видите загрузку памяти выше 85-90% в обычном режиме работы, то добавление RAM кардинально решит проблему. Если память загружена лишь частично, проблема кроется в программном обеспечении или драйверах.
Стоит ли отключать прозрачность окон?
На старых компьютерах и ноутбуках без мощной видеокарты отключение прозрачности (эффекта Aero или Acrylic) действительно снижает нагрузку на GPU и делает переключение окон более плавным. Это можно сделать в настройках персонализации.